Summary
Position: VP / Director of Construction
Location: Hartford, Connecticut / New York (Regional Travel Required)
Duration: Full-time
Reports To: Executive Leadership
Direct Reports: 6-7 (Project Managers)
Experience Required: 10+ years in Construction Leadership
Industry: Commercial Construction (some Residential experience preferred)
Position Overview
We are conducting a confidential search for a Vice President / Director of Construction to lead, grow, and elevate an established construction business unit. This role requires a strategic, hands-on leader with proven experience overseeing multiple large-scale projects, managing diverse teams, and driving operational excellence across commercial and residential construction sectors.
The successful candidate will be responsible for saturating and expanding the company''s footprint across Connecticut and New York, ensuring top-quality project delivery, client satisfaction, and sustainable business growth.
Key Responsibilities
- Provide executive leadership and strategic direction for all construction operations across CT and NY.
- Oversee and mentor a team of 6-7 direct reports-Project Managers.
- Develop and execute business growth strategies to expand market share in commercial construction while supporting select high-end residential projects.
- Manage full project life cycle, from preconstruction and budgeting through closeout and client handoff.
- Partner with executive leadership to set and achieve annual business goals, financial targets, and operational KPIs.
- Foster a culture of safety, quality, accountability, and continuous improvement.
- Identify new market opportunities, partnerships, and client relationships to support regional growth.
- Ensure projects meet or exceed profitability targets, schedule requirements, and client expectations.
- Oversee resource allocation, project forecasting, and workforce planning.
- Represent the company with professionalism and integrity in all client, vendor, and community interactions.
Qualifications
- 10+ years of progressive experience in construction management, with at least 5 years in a senior leadership role.
- Strong background in commercial construction (restoration, interiors, retail, office, institutional, or light industrial); residential experience is a plus.
- Proven success leading multi-disciplinary teams and managing complex, concurrent projects.
- Deep understanding of construction operations, project controls, and financial management.
- Strategic thinker with the ability to implement growth and operational improvement initiatives.
- Excellent communication, leadership, and relationship-building skills.
- Bachelors degree in Construction Management, Engineering, or related field (Masters preferred).
- Willingness to travel across Connecticut and New York as needed to oversee projects and meet clients.
